Can money buy happiness yes or no?
A new study says that, yes, it can. A new study by the University of Pennsylvania says that money can buy you happiness, and there might not even be a limit. But if your income doubles, you still see a boost in happiness, no matter how much you were making before.

How much money do you need to buy happiness?
Americans earning more than $85,000 a year are happier than those who earn less. A study in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ences found that the more you earn, the happier you are. What is the word for making someone feel better?
consolation Add to list Share. Consolation is something that makes someone feel better after they’re disappointed or sad. This is a word for things that try to console someone. You give someone consolation when try to cheer them up.
